Inattentive Behavior By Sam5

Kids just don't have to pay attention for any length of time anywhere but at school. We have DVD players and game systems in cars. I see kids often bringing in hand held game systems to restaurants, movies, concerts,etc,.. any time they have to wait. They rarely have to sit through church any more. Many do not sit with their families at meals and eat and listen to other family members talk. Usually there is a TV on. Simple bike rides, walks, playing outside and using your imagination are activities that many children no longer do.
The point is that while I sat quietly for long periods of time in | | school when I was young, I also was expected to be quiet and listen in many other areas of my life. I don't think we are going to change society or the students. I think, as educators, we are going to have to come up with ways to teach these kids and also how to teach them to become more attentive.
